East Africa: Econet Media Launches Free-to-Air Sports Channel With Exclusives

12 August 2016

One would say with the market today content is key but also it has to be targeted to a certain niche otherwise you end up producing a lot of it but all jumbled up hence losing out completely. Econet media portfolio launched a free-to-air channel, Kwesé Free Sports with exclusive premium sports rights in both local and international content.

Viewers can also live stream the channel on the Kwesé Now app as the company launched earlier this year and is also trying to acquire online rights for its online audience.
